The Primary Components of a Professional-Grade Fish Filleting Knife

A quality fish filleting knife is characterized by several important aspects that heighten its execution and practicality. The cutting surface material is crucial; high-carbon stainless steel is favored for its sharpness and resistance from corrosion. A tapered, thin blade makes possible for precise slices, assuring clean fillets. The length of the blade typically extends from 6 to 9 inches, granting versatility for various fish sizes.

The handle is another essential part, ideally made from materials like rubber or hardwood that offer a solid, balanced grip. A well-balanced knife prevents fatigue during extended use, allowing for superior control. Additionally, a adaptable blade can aid in maneuvering the contours of the fish, making it easier to separate flesh from bone. Finally, a non-slip design boosts safety, reducing the hazard of accidents while filleting. These features jointly contribute to an efficient and enjoyable filleting experience.

Top Varieties for Fish Filleting Knife Blades

Picking the suitable knife steel is essential for productive fish filleting. Stainless steel gives toughness and anti-rust properties, while high carbon steel is known for its edge quality and blade longevity. Ceramic blades, conversely, provide a feather-light option with excellent sharpness, though they require careful handling.

Stainless Steel Strengths

When it comes to selecting materials for blades used in fish filleting knives, stainless steel stands out as a top option due to its distinct blend of durability, corrosion resistance, and ease of maintenance. This alloy is particularly beneficial in aquatic environments, where exposure to moisture can lead similar information to rust and degradation in lesser materials. Its inherent strength allows for the creation of thin, flexible blades that facilitate precise cuts, essential for effective filleting. Additionally, stainless steel requires minimal upkeep; a quick rinse and wipe after use is often sufficient to maintain its performance. This practicality, combined with its visual attractiveness, makes stainless steel a favored choice among both amateur and professional fish filleting enthusiasts.

High Carbon Steel Qualities

High carbon steel positions itself as a dependable alternative for fish filleting knife blades, imparting brilliant sharpness and sustained sharpness. Unlike stainless steel, high carbon steel can secure and maintain a more precise point, making it advantageous for the intricate cuts core to filleting. The material is acclaimed for its hardness, which reinforces its competence to endure repeated use without dulling quickly. Additionally, high carbon steel blades can be easier to sharpen compared to their stainless counterparts, facilitating a user-specific sharpness calibrated to the user's preferences. However, they do involve more maintenance to inhibit rusting, making attentive maintenance paramount. Overall, high carbon steel yields a synthesis of performance and range, appealing to both amateur and professional fishers alike.

Ceramic Blade Characteristics

Ceramic blades represent an innovative choice for fish filleting, known for their remarkable durability and resistance to wear. Unlike conventional metal blades, ceramic alternatives retain sharpness extended periods, reducing the frequency of sharpening. Constructed from advanced materials, these blades are light in weight, allowing for easy maneuverability during filleting tasks. Additionally, ceramic is resistant to corrosion, rendering it an outstanding choice for use in moist environments. However, the brittleness of ceramic can present a risk; improper handling or dropping the knife may result in chipping or breakage. While ceramic blades excel in precision and longevity, users should be mindful of their limitations. Overall, ceramic filleting knives offer a unique blend of performance and durability for avid fishers.

Critical Care Suggestions for Your Filleting Knife

A filleting knife needs essential maintenance to ensure its longevity and functionality. Regular cleaning is critical; following each use, the blade must be washed with warm, soapy water and dried promptly to avoid rust and oxidation. Steer clear of using abrasive materials that can scratch the blade's surface.

Proper placement is a crucial aspect of attention. A knife cover or magnetic strip can preserve the blade from injury and keep it guarded when not in use. In addition, regular honing is encouraged to copyright the acuteness of the blade, while trained sharpening should be done as needed to achieve peak cutting performance.

To summarize, it is necessary to operate the knife with care, avoiding excessive force that could bend or break the blade. By following these essential care tips, practitioners can lengthen the lifespan of their filleting knives and confirm steady, effective performance during fish preparation.
